AM6 has now been rolled out to all schools and there is support available for the software. EIS will continue to run their training courses and provide the helpdesk service to schools. Management Information will be offering training and support in terms of pupil tracking and value added.
Training courses on the Performance Analysis module will be available through Management Information as will telephone support for analysis and pupil tracking queries.
Management Information has also developed a series of templates for the recording and analysis of pupil data, and these templates, designed to save schools a substantial amount of time, are available on this page.
